tensorflow loss值一直为nan

如图所示:一组数据我无论建立CNN或者ANN其结果都会显示loss为nan。我最初怀疑是tensorflow的问题,我随机建立了y=x**2+x的方程,其loss值不为nan,然后我调小了学习速率,batch_size其结果均为nan,只有将将权重随机化之后,其loss值不为nan,但是也没有下降,实在不晓得为啥了,我是图像分类,我也照抄了tensorflow的教程依旧如此,我检查了数据没有nan值存在,所以目前还没有找到原因。

 

自说自话,找到原因了,因为版本问题